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Broad Green to Bootle Oriel Road start from £4.80 one way, or £4.90 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don't want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Broad Green to Bootle Oriel Road are available for £5.10 one way, or £6.70 return

Facilities and Services

Broad Green Station, while currently closed for refurbishment until Winter 2024, is normally well-equipped with various facilities designed to ensure a comfortable journey. The station features a ticket office with extensive opening hours and provides ticket machines that allow passengers to not only buy tickets but also collect those purchased online. Smart card issuance and validation facilities further enhance the convenience for tech-savvy travellers.

Access to information and help is a priority here, with help points and departure screens readily available. While there's no waiting room, seating areas are accessible for many tired feet. Though lacking in refreshment options and shops, the nearby area compensates with local amenities. Make sure to plan accordingly, as the toilets and baby changing facilities are not available on-site.

Accessibility Features

Understanding the importance of providing comprehensive access, Broad Green Station offers partial step-free access, and ramps are available for train boarding. For passengers needing assistance, it is advisable to book through Passenger Assist, which allows arrangements up to two hours before traveling. Unfortunately, there are no accessible toilets or dedicated pick-up points, emphasizing the need for pre-travel arrangements if required.

Onward Travel and Local Transport Connections

If your journey requires connections to other modes of transport, Broad Green has you covered. Rail replacement services and local bus links outside the station connect you further afield, with options to journey towards Liverpool at the Turnpike Tavern or Warrington directly from the bus stop at the station entrance. For those preferring the privacy of a taxi, the online service Cab4You is a convenient choice.

Cyclists will also find limited bicycle storage, complete with CCTV for added peace of mind. Do note that cycle hire isn't available at the station, so bring your own if you're planning to pedal your way around the locale.

Facilities at Bootle Oriel Road Station

The station features a ticket office with generous opening times every day of the week—perfect for those early morning commutes or late-night returns. While there aren't any ticket machines available, you can easily collect tickets purchased online from the ticket office. Smartcards are also issued and can be validated at this location, proving to be a hassle-free option for regular rail users. Assistance for passengers with accessibility needs is available, offering step-free access, lifts to the platforms, and accessible toilets.

Don't worry if you need a bit of help; customer information and help points are available with staff presence during ticket office hours. For a comfortable wait, the station provides seating areas and indoor waiting spaces. There's even a baby changing station for travelers with young children. Though there are no refreshment facilities directly at the station, the introduction of facilities such as free secure cycle storage encourages sustainable travel options.

Beyond the Tracks: Onward Travel from Bootle Oriel Road

Despite the absence of a taxi rank or cycle hire facilities, Bootle Oriel Road has you covered with rail replacement services operating from Oriel Road. For bus journeys, connections can be easily arranged with help from Merseytravel services. Moreover, the station enjoys a handy connection with Liverpool John Lennon Airport. When traveling to the airport, purchase a combined rail and bus ticket for convenience—it’s your straightforward ticket from train to plane.

Should you want more information on onward travel options, head over to the Merseytravel website or contact Traveline for expert advice on bus connections.
